Oaktree Specialty Lending Corporation (OCSL)
NASDAQ: OCSL · Real-Time Price · USD
12.13
-0.41 (-3.27%)
At close: Feb 5, 2026, 4:00 PM EST
12.24
+0.11 (0.91%)
After-hours: Feb 5, 2026, 7:54 PM EST

Oaktree Specialty Lending Ratios and Metrics

Millions USD. Fiscal year is Oct - Sep.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Sep '25 Sep '24 Sep '23 Sep '22 Sep '21
1,0681,1501,3411,5511,1001,273
Market Cap Growth
-17.36%-14.31%-13.50%40.96%-13.59%86.64%
Enterprise Value
2,6022,5342,9763,2712,4532,293
Last Close Price
12.1312.6713.9815.2711.9812.84
PE Ratio
32.8933.8923.1713.2237.655.37
Forward PE
8.418.447.308.077.9711.58
PS Ratio
3.483.633.524.094.196.08
PB Ratio
0.740.780.901.020.880.97
P/TBV Ratio
0.740.780.901.020.880.97
P/OCF Ratio
1107.235.0370.326.7849.13-
PEG Ratio
-6.146.146.146.146.14
EV/Sales Ratio
8.528.007.808.629.3510.95
EV/EBIT Ratio
10.129.449.8011.1912.5517.97
Debt / Equity Ratio
1.121.021.111.091.080.97
Asset Turnover
0.100.100.120.130.100.10
Quick Ratio
2.753.172.735.522.281.20
Current Ratio
2.923.372.995.782.451.28
Return on Equity (ROE)
2.24%2.30%3.86%8.50%2.28%21.30%
Return on Assets (ROA)
5.20%5.41%5.92%6.23%4.63%3.73%
Return on Invested Capital (ROIC)
8.71%8.91%9.95%10.31%7.56%6.15%
Return on Capital Employed (ROCE)
8.40%9.10%9.70%9.20%7.60%4.90%
Earnings Yield
3.02%2.95%4.32%7.57%2.66%18.63%
Dividend Yield
12.76%13.82%15.74%14.34%16.27%11.80%
Payout Ratio
445.91%436.91%305.35%153.45%394.37%33.66%
Buyback Yield / Dilution
-7.38%-7.04%-11.51%-18.76%-12.38%-15.01%
Total Shareholder Return
5.80%6.78%4.23%-4.42%3.90%-3.21%
Updated Feb 4, 2026.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q